The doctrine of judicial estoppel is inapplicable because NY Title has not obtained any relief based on any of its allegedly competing positions (see D & L Holdings v Goldman Co., 287 A.D.2d 65, 71-72 [1st Dept 2001], lv denied 97 N.Y.2d 611 [2002]; see also Angel v Bank of Tokyo-Mitsubishi, Ltd., 39 A.D.3d 368, 371 [1st Dept 2007]).
